China News Service, Moscow, December 17 (Reporter Wang Xiujun) The website of the Chinese Embassy in Russia published on the 16th an interview with the Russian "Izvestia", the Chinese Ambassador to Russia Zhang Hanhui.

During the period, Zhang Hanhui mentioned that facing the severe challenges of the global spread of the new crown pneumonia epidemic and the global economic downturn, China-Russia energy cooperation has shown strong resilience and vitality, energy trade has grown substantially, and major cooperation projects have been steadily advanced.

  Zhang Hanhui said that China is a major energy consumer and importer in the world, with oil as the core power source and natural gas as the clean energy source of choice to replace coal. In the future, China will still account for a considerable proportion of China's energy consumption.

China is willing to actively promote cooperation on major strategic projects with Russia, carry out cooperation on small and medium-sized projects, and pragmatically promote cooperation in the fields of energy technology and equipment, innovative research and development, renewable energy, hydrogen energy, and energy storage, and use more local currencies to carry out energy trade settlement and projects Investment and Financing.

  Zhang Hanhui responded to the question of “what other Chinese brands might meet with Russians in the future and the question when they are popular in Russia” said that in recent years, Chinese manufacturing has paid more attention to improving product quality, strengthening technological innovation and cultivating independent brands.

The comprehensive competitiveness and market share of Chinese products in the international arena are constantly increasing.

While well-known communication terminal brands such as Huawei and Xiaomi continue to serve the modernization of Russian communications, smartphone brands such as VIVO, OPPO, and Meizu; computer brands such as Lenovo, Shenzhou and Tsinghua Tongfang; TV brands such as Konka, Skyworth and Changhong and Haier Refrigerator brands such as, Midea and TCL are also more favored by Russian consumers.

  Zhang Hanhui said that China's electromechanical products have strong market potential.

Harvard, Geely, BYD and other brands of cars will shine in the fields of new energy and environmental protection.

In addition, more high-quality clothing, bags, shoes and hats and other light industrial products, traditional Chinese medicine products, Chinese food and beverages will also appear in the daily lives of the Russian people.
